The gateway service emits roughly 40k lines per minute, most of it duplicate health-check chatter. Agreed to apply head-based sampling at 5% for info-level logs while keeping warnings and errors unsampled. Trace-linked lines will bypass sampling so incident debugging stays intact. Rollout goes to the canary pool first, with a one-week observation window before fleet-wide enablement. Future maintainers: the sampling config lives in the gateway chart. Ownership of the sampling policy sits with one person.

account owner for bawip-tahag: Raleth Quenok

**Q: Can my plugin trigger a rebalancing run directly?**

No. Plugins for the Spokewise rebalancer can only submit dock-pressure hints; the core scheduler decides when trucks move. Hints expire after fifteen minutes and are weighted by station priority tier. To register a hint provider and review the scoring model, see the integration guide at the page below.

wiki page, bagaf-fawip: https://harbor.tolvaqsys.local/pages/repo/pages/secrets/eac969ffc71f356b

## Sensor drift: what to do at 3am

If the GrowLoop controller starts reporting humidity swings that don't match the backup probes in the Fernwick greenhouse, it's almost always sensor drift, not an actual climate event. Don't panic and don't touch the vents manually. First, restart the calibration daemon and give it ten minutes to re-baseline. If readings still disagree by more than 5%, flip the controller into safe mode. The safe-mode thresholds it will use are these.

config for yahap-bajof:
[istix]
host = istix.qorvelsys.internal
user = istix_svc
database = istix_prod